Install syncthing-fork on both of your phones, and leave your pixel plugged in at home. Setup syncthing to sync your camera folder from your real phone. Any time you take a photo or video it'll immediately transfer directly to your pixel and backup to Google photos from there. It's like having the unlimited original quality Google photos storage deal on any phone.

You can even download all the photos and videos you have in your Google photos account currently (Google takeout makes this easy), delete them from Google photos, copy them to your pixel 1 camera folder, and they'll upload back into your Google Photos account, but take up no space.

And if anyone wants in on this, just buy a used pixel 1. All photos and videos that upload to Google Photos from a pixel 1 take up no storage space on your account, regardless of what device you used to capture them. It's free lifetime unlimited original quality photo and video cloud storage.

At some point in the future the OS on the original pixel will become too old to run the latest Google photos app, and this loophole will end, but anything you upload until that time is free to store forever.
